📖 Overview
Small Signal Audio Design is a technical reference book focused on analog audio circuit design and engineering principles. The book covers the fundamentals through advanced concepts of designing high-performance audio equipment.
The text examines core topics including operational amplifiers, noise reduction, distortion minimization, power supplies, and equalization circuits. Each chapter contains practical examples, measurements, and real-world applications that demonstrate key concepts.
Topics are supported by extensive measurements, graphs, schematics and mathematical analysis that enable readers to understand the principles behind audio circuit behavior. The book maintains a focus on achievable, cost-effective designs that can be implemented in both commercial and DIY audio projects.
This work serves as both an educational text and practical handbook for audio engineers, with an emphasis on empirical testing and proven design approaches rather than theoretical ideals. The material synthesizes decades of audio engineering experience into actionable design strategies.

🤔 Interesting facts
🎵 Author Douglas Self has been designing audio equipment for over 40 years and holds numerous patents in audio technology.
🔊 The book delves into both traditional analog and modern digital audio design techniques, making it relevant for both vintage and contemporary equipment.
⚡ One unique aspect covered is the impact of component tolerances on audio circuits - even tiny variations can affect sound quality in ways many designers overlook.
🔧 The text includes detailed analysis of often-ignored aspects like volume control design and switching systems that can significantly impact overall audio performance.
📊 Self challenges several popular audiophile myths through empirical testing and measurement data, including the alleged superiority of certain expensive components over standard ones.
